Sesión 9: Base de datos (BD)

 ¿Qué significa base de datos?

Colección de datos interrelacionados y almacenados en conjunto sin redundancias, con la finalidad de servir a una aplicación.


Elementos de las bases de datos: 

  • Campos: Es un ítem elemento de datos como: Nombre, número de empleados, ciudad, código, etc.
  • Registros: Colección de campos lógicamente relacionados que pueden ser tratados como una unidad por algún programa.
  • Archivo: colección de registros relacionados entre sí con aspectos en común y organizados para un propósito específicos.

Gestores de base de datos:

Es un conjunto de programas que nos permiten gestionar bases de datos. Es decir, realiza las funciones de modificar, extraer y almacenar información de una base de datos, además de poseer herramientas con funciones de eliminar, modificar, analizar, etc.

se divide en dos:
  • Relacionales (SQL) : 
Es un lenguaje de computación para trabajar con conjuntos de datos y las relaciones entre ellos.
Son las más conocidas por su amplia difusión y su sencillez en la gestión y mantenimiento.
Este tipo de base de datos caracteriza las conexiones dela base de datos como tablas conformando una estructura lógica uniforme y comprensible.
El lenguaje SQL se divide en distintos tipos de instrucciones en el lenguaje principal son: DML, DDL,DCL y TCL
  • No relacionales (NoSQL)
Se basa en la estructuración predefinida de relaciones entre puntos de datos de las tablas y utilizando claves(registros únicos en cada tabla) para conformar la estructura de conexiones.
Esta estructura debe mostrar que la base de datos sea accesible, escalable, rápida y precisa. 
Algunas de las bases de datos más conocidas son Microsoft SQL Server, Oracle Database, MySQL e IBMDB2.

Ejemplo de una base de datos

Actividad grupal de la sesión:










Comentarios

Entradas populares